Cast Iron Weight Plates Reviews

Based on 7 reviews from Gym Radar users, the Signature Fitness Cast Iron Weight Plates have an average rating of 3.90 out of 5. They're currently the #19 most-owned Iron on Gym Radar, with 20 home gyms reporting ownership.

Cheap weight is necessary. Cheap weight allows you to spend more where it counts. I’ve purchased some 45# DD as well as 25,10,5 and 2.5 plates and the 45s look like complete garbage but the other plates asr better visually. I think these are perfectly fine if you don’t want to go higher end / quality or if your buying plates for machines.
